Output d386653b76eca8062cc952fee027c4dcb307721e57ce3d806e197e9463bc3cc3:54

value
168832505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a25ae61f10e18be020fa2772ef99d697765f1373 OP_EQUAL
address
3GVUHPRPgZRuMqAfvp5iAXVNqwJ1HRCbZJ
transaction
d386653b76eca8062cc952fee027c4dcb307721e57ce3d806e197e9463bc3cc3
spent
true